I set the cursor onto the hour, and put in digits by numblock-keys (numlock is ON). The time changes, but also the orientation of my pic changes, too. This happens only when I make the changes by keyboard with 7, 8, or 9 (the same keys as shown in menu rotating), by klick onto the "+/-"-Arrows it works as expected.
